Visa card vulnerability can bypass contactless limits
- 5 years 6 months ago
- Payments
Positive Technologies has today announced that researchers Leigh-Anne Galloway and Timur Yunusov have discovered flaws that allow hackers to bypass the payment limits on Visa contactless cards. Positive Technologies tested the attack with five major UK banks, successfully bypassing the UK contactless verification limit of £30 on all tested Visa cards, irrespective of the card terminal. Sberbank clients get ‘personalised’ ATMs
Sberbank has personalised the menu of its ATMs. Now, after a client enters their PIN code they will see a main screen that features the options they have used the most in the past, as well as relevant personal offers from the bank. In particular, the system suggests the amount the client should withdraw based on their past cash withdrawals and even wishes them a happy birthday and offers a present. SWIFT MT format: valantic FinCASE supports ISO 20022
- 5 years 6 months ago
- Payments
In November 2021, the SWIFT migration starts with replacing SWIFT MT formats and introducing XML formats in the field of large-value payment transactions. As of November this year, banks already have to support certain processes for complaints of SEPA payments. valantic’s FinCASE is a proven solution for processing exceptions and investigations and the software already supports ISO 20022-based complaints.
